The Mechanics of the Golden Glaze

So, what makes the Golden Glaze so elusive? The answer lies in the science of bread-making. The perfect crust requires a delicate balance of temperature, humidity, and chemical reactions. It’s a process that involves manipulating the bread’s natural starches, proteins, and sugars to create a crispy, golden-brown exterior.

But even with the best techniques and equipment, achieving the Golden Glaze remains an art. It requires patience, intuition, and a deep understanding of the bread’s internal dynamics. This is where the magic happens – when the baker’s touch combines with the bread’s natural chemistry to create that perfect, golden crust.

The Role of Ingredients and Equipment

While the science behind the Golden Glaze is complex, the ingredients and equipment required are surprisingly straightforward. A good bread-making starter, a quality flour blend, and a well-calibrated oven are essential. But it’s the nuances of temperature, proofing time, and scoring that can make or break the crust.
